Delhi announces free booster doses amid spurt in Covid-19 cases

| @indiablooms | Apr 22, 2022, at 05:38 am

New Delhi/IBNS: As the Covid-19 cases are on the rise in the national capital, the Delhi government on Thursday announced that the precautionary vaccine doses will be available free for everyone in the age group 18-59 years at all government-run hospitals.

"In order to give the benefit of precaution dose to all eligible beneficiaries in Delhi, the same will be available for 18 to 59 years' age group, free of cost in all government CVCs from April 21," the health department said in the order.

Necessary changes have been made in the Co-WIN portal for Delhi wherein both "online appointment and walk-in will be available," it added.

Delhi logged 965 fresh Covid-19 cases in the last 24-hour period with a positivity rate of 4.71 per cent.

One person has died due to the infection during this period, according to data from the health department.

On Wednesday, the city reported one death and 1,009 Covid cases, the maximum since Feb 10, with a positivity rate of 5.7 per cent.

The Delhi Disaster Management Authority (DDMA) on Wednesday reinforced the mask mandate in the national capital making not wearing the same in public places a punishable offence attracting a fine of Rs 500, officials said.

India too reported a spike in Covid cases reported with 2,380 fresh infections in the last 24 hours while the toll went up by 56 in this period, the Union Health Ministry said on Thursday.
